Transaction 108705d5942995e0e3b4f56adb334312e514ecb5a2638c8aa4234b7429172779

1 Input
2 Outputs
  • 108705d5942995e0e3b4f56adb334312e514ecb5a2638c8aa4234b7429172779:0
  • value  31249980156
    address  n4nsxMMaYnXv8pjZvLPXUDADfv9PTsXm6o
  • 108705d5942995e0e3b4f56adb334312e514ecb5a2638c8aa4234b7429172779:1
  • value  31249980156
    address  n4nsXFDeypRcXZ4oaqtCstZNTFT3e1qMau